The 22-year-old arrived as a teenager from Porto in 2017, intending to become the long-term right-back at United after a promising spell in Portugal.

Unfortunately, life in Manchester has not gone as well as he would have liked, struggling to hold down the spot before eventually being replaced by Aaron Wan-Bissaka.

However, Dalot is fresh from a successful season in Serie A, where he helped Milan reach the Champions League for the first time since the 2013/14
